Description: The 15th International conference on Semi-Solid Processing of Alloys and Composites (S2P) are dedicated to the science and technology of semi-solid processing of metals, alloys and composites. Since the discovery of the distinctive flow behavior of metals in the semi-solid state during the early seventies, this fascinating technology has experienced a dynamic and turbulent development history, which has led to a whole family of new production processes, new equipment, and industrial applications with the goal of exploiting this characteristic flow behavior for technical and economic benefits.

Description: This book contains selected contributions presented on the 14th conference “Contribution of Metallography to Production Problem Solutions” held on 6 – 8 June 2017 in the Mariánské Lázně, Czech Republic. The conference was focused on application of metallography in industrial practice - for solution of production problems, elucidation of premature failure of machine components and constructions during service, breakdowns or accidents. In addition some results of new research projects which could improve manufacturing technology or quality of machine parts are presented. Individual papers deal with failure causes and fracture mechanism, insufficient material properties and incorrect function of the components. Using metallographic analyses, which include light and electron microscopy, spectroscopic methods, physical methods for detection of defects, material structures are investigated. Results are correlated with material properties and recommendations for production technologies improvement are given.

The 1st Conference on Physical Modeling for Virtual Manufacturing Systems and Processes is the result of the International Research Training Group (IRTG) 2057 "Physical Modeling for Virtual Manufacturing Systems and Processes", funded by the German Research Foundation (DFG). The IRTG began on 01 July 2014. Partner University of the University of Kaiserslautern, is the University of California, with its locations in Berkeley and Davis. At the conference the progress and the results of the first cohort of PhD students was presented. The conference was complemented by talks of international guest speakers from computer science and manufacturing engineering. The proceedings contain 22 peer-reviewed papers on Physical Modeling for Virtual Manufacturing Systems and Processes.
